2013-05-18 5 views
0

Hey, c'est une question très simple, mais je ne trouve tout simplement pas la réponse. Je sais que c'est la façon dont vous testez wether le fichier que vous avez téléchargé est en effet un fichier image:Comment tester si le fichier téléchargé est un fichier epub?

if($_FILES["file"]["type"] == "image/png") 

échange Juste le png avec l'extension de fichier wichever vous acceptez. Je veux juste savoir comment utiliser cette instruction pour tester un fichier .epub? Quelle est la première partie avant le / va être?

Merci d'avance.

+0

Je pense seulement à utiliser if ($ _ FICHIERS ["file"] ["type"] == "epub") –

+0

Je pense qu'il devrait être 'application/epub + zip'. –

Répondre

1

Il suffit d'écrire un simple script de téléchargement qui imprime $_FILES["file"]["type"] sur l'écran et de télécharger un fichier du type recherché

+0

merci essayé cela et cela m'a aidé à trouver le bon type. –

0

Le type est l'information fournie par le client MIME. Une partie des informations pour c'est here j'ai trouvé sur Internet

Essayez

($_FILES["file"]["type"] == "epub") 
0

Ok j'ai donc écrit un script qui vient affiche le type de fichier et la sortie était « application/octet-stream »

Cela a également travaillé pour tester si le fichier est de type epub.

Questions connexes